"Six Primroses Each" by Ellen Dryden is set in a small, intimate town where the intricacies of human relationships unfold. The play explores themes of love, loss, and the passage of time as it follows the lives of six characters, each connected by a shared history and the symbolism of primroses. Through their interactions, the characters confront their pasts, revealing deep emotional ties and unresolved conflicts that shape their present lives. The narrative ultimately highlights the importance of healing and understanding in the face of life's challenges.
